Regulatory Agencies and Their Role in Radar System Compliance

Regulatory agencies are essential in ensuring radar systems meet legal standards for safe and effective operation. They establish guidelines and standards that govern radar testing activities to prevent interference and protect public interest. These agencies include national authorities like the Federal Communications Commission (FCC) in the United States and similar bodies worldwide.

Their role extends to licensing and overseeing spectrum allocation, ensuring that radar testing complies with frequency management policies. By issuing permits, they regulate the power levels and operational parameters of radar systems during testing. This oversight mitigates risks of signal interference with other communications services.

Additionally, regulatory agencies enforce compliance through inspections and audits, ensuring adherence to established laws. They also monitor new technological developments and update regulations accordingly. Their involvement is critical for maintaining lawful practices while fostering innovation within the boundaries of legal considerations in radar testing.

Navigating Frequency Allocation and Spectrum Management Laws

Navigating frequency allocation and spectrum management laws is a fundamental aspect of legal considerations in radar testing. These laws govern how radio frequencies are distributed and used across different sectors to prevent interference. Compliance ensures radar systems operate within designated bands, avoiding legal conflicts.

Regulatory agencies such as the Federal Communications Commission (FCC) in the United States or the International Telecommunication Union (ITU) at the global level oversee spectrum allocation. They establish guidelines and licensing procedures that radar operators must follow before commencing testing activities.

Operators must also conduct thorough spectrum analysis to identify available frequencies and avoid disruptions to existing services. This involves understanding the specific frequency bands allocated for radar use and adhering to restrictions on power emissions. Proper management reduces the risk of interference with other radio services and ensures operational legality.

Permitting and Certification Requirements for Radar Testing

Permitting and certification requirements for radar testing are critical aspects of ensuring legal compliance within the radar systems industry. These requirements typically involve submitting detailed proposals to relevant authorities to obtain necessary approvals before commencing testing operations. Authorities scrutinize the technical specifications, operational parameters, and potential interference issues to safeguard spectrum integrity and listener privacy.

Certification processes often mandate demonstrating adherence to established safety and performance standards. This may include testing reports, technical documentation, and compliance with international and national regulations. Such certification verifies that radar systems operate within authorized frequency bands and power levels, minimizing interference with other technologies and services.

Failure to secure proper permits or certification can lead to significant legal penalties, operational delays, and reputational damage. Therefore, organizations engaged in radar testing must proactively identify relevant regulatory bodies and maintain ongoing communications. Staying compliant ensures not only legal integrity but also supports smooth technological development and innovation within the radar systems sector.

International Laws and Cross-Border Radar Testing Challenges

Navigating international laws in radar testing presents complex challenges due to differing legal frameworks across borders. Countries have specific regulations governing spectrum use, safety standards, and operational permissions, which can vary significantly.

Cross-border radar testing must comply with both domestic and international agreements, including treaties and spectrum sharing protocols. Non-compliance may result in legal penalties, delays, or equipment confiscation, making thorough legal due diligence vital prior to testing.

Coordination among nations and regulatory agencies is essential to prevent interference with other radar systems and sensitive communications. Establishing clear communication channels ensures adherence to shared standards and reduces potential conflicts, fostering smoother cross-border operations.
